1. Heat a large skillet to medium heat. Add in the butter and olive oil, then add in the shrimp. Sauté for a few minutes, until they are just turning pink, then remove and set aside.
2. Add in the garlic and sauté for about 20 seconds, careful not to burn it! Then add in the rest of the ingredients and continue cooking while stirring often.
3. Simmer on low for about 5 minutes or until thickened to your liking. Add the shrimp back in for about a minute, tossing to coat in the sauce.
4. Pour over zucchini noodles, spaghetti squash or shirataki noodles and serve!
